The era of boring video squares is over. If you want an immersive digital party, you need a space that feels like a real room.

Spatial audio is the secret sauce here. In these apps, your voice gets louder as you “walk” closer to someone and quieter as you move away. This lets people have small side chats just like at a real house party.

Action Items:

  • Try “Gather” or “Teamflow” for a 2D map where you can move an avatar.
  • Check out “Microsoft Mesh” if you want to use VR headsets for a 3D experience.
  • Use “Rec Room” for a free, fun world where guests can play mini-games together.
  • Host a “Watch Party” hub through your browser to stream movies or TikToks in sync.
See also  27 Creative Summer Birthday Party Ideas for Adults

These platforms stop the “one person speaks at a time” rule. They let your guests mingle. It feels more natural and less like a lecture. Once the venue is set, you need the fun.

Pro Tip: Always send a “Quick Start” link 24 hours early. This helps guests set up their avatars so they don’t spend the first 20 minutes of your party fixing their settings.

Pick Fun Remote Birthday Activities

Entertainment is the heartbeat of your party. You cannot just sit and talk for two hours. Recent data from Grand View Research shows the virtual events market grew by 40% recently. This means there are now thousands of professional ways to stay busy online.

Online celebration ideas for 2026:

  1. AI-Hosted Trivia: Use an AI bot to pull niche facts about your friendship group. It can track scores and even crack jokes in real time.
  2. Digital Escape Rooms: Teams work together in a breakout room to solve puzzles. This is great for groups that don’t know each other well.
  3. Hire e-Performers: You can book a magician or a DJ to join your call for 30 minutes. It breaks up the night and gives everyone a shared focus.
  4. Synchronized Food: Use DoorDash for Business to send everyone a $20 gift card. Everyone orders at the same time so you can “eat together.”

One group recently sent a physical cake kit to ten different cities. Everyone baked their cake before the call, then had a decorating contest live.

It made the digital space feel physical. But fun requires coordination. Let’s talk about the boring stuff that makes the party work.

3 Ways to Fix Your Party Logistics

How to Organize a Virtual Birthday Party 2

The small details can ruin a good plan. You have to think about time zones and tech issues before they happen. If you have friends in London and Los Angeles, someone is going to be tired.

Action Items:

  • Use smart RSVP tools. Use a site that automatically adds the event to your guests’ Google or Outlook calendars in their local time.
  • Set a “Tech-Check” window. Open the room 15 minutes early. Tell guests this is the time to fix their mics and cameras.
  • Send a “Digital Swag Bag.” Send a folder with custom Canva backgrounds, a Spotify playlist link, and maybe a small NFT or a discount code for a coffee shop.

You should also use an AI Co-Host. These bots can manage your music queue. They also help everyone sing “Happy Birthday” at the exact same time by fixing the audio lag.

This stops that painful, out-of-sync singing that happens on old apps. With the plan in place, you are ready to hit “Go Live.”
